KALAMAZOO, MI – The Rutgers volleyball team (1-3)
  dropped its first match at the Radisson Invitational, losing to tournament
  hosts Western Michigan 30-16, 34-32, 30-17 on Sept. 10.
The Scarlet Knights were led by sophomore Lora Yankauskas (Paramus, NJ), who
  notched a team best 12 kills. It marked the fourth consecutive match in which
  Yankauskas has recorded double-digit kills. Senior Abbey Martin (Topeka, KS)
  added a team-high 26 assists, while senior Dawn Christjaener tallied a team-high
  five digs.
RU will return to action as it takes on Marquette at 12:00 p.m. and first-time
  opponent Maine at 4:30 p.m. on the final day of competition at the Radisson
  Invitational on Sept. 11.
